文章 2024-11-09 来自:开发者社区

【详细实用のMyBatis教程】获取参数值和结果的各种情况、自定义映射、动态SQL、多级缓存、逆向工程、分页插件

【详细实用のMyBatis教程】获取参数值和结果的各种情况、自定义映射、动态SQL、多级缓存、逆向工程、分页插件

【详细实用のMyBatis教程】获取参数值和结果的各种情况、自定义映射、动态SQL、多级缓存、逆向工程、分页插件
文章 2024-01-07 来自:开发者社区

Mybatis之自定义映射resultMap

学习的最大理由是想摆脱平庸,早一天就多一份人生的精彩;迟一天就多一天平庸的困扰。各位小伙伴,如果您:想系统/深入学习某技术知识点…一个人摸索学习很难坚持,想组团高效学习…想写博客但无从下手,急需写作干货注入能量…热爱写作,愿意让自己成为更好的人…文章目录前言一、resultMap处理字段和属性的映射关系二、多对一映射处理1、级联方式处理映射关系2、使用association处理映射关系3、分步查....

Mybatis之自定义映射resultMap
文章 2023-09-14 来自:开发者社区

【MyBatis】自定义resultMap三种映射关系

一、一对一映射(One-to-One)1.1 表关系         一对一映射是指一个对象与另一个对象具有一对一的关系。例如,一个用户(User)与一个地址(Address)之间的关系。假设我们有以下表结构:user 表:id (int) name (varchar) address_id (int)address 表:id (int) street (....

【MyBatis】自定义resultMap三种映射关系
文章 2023-08-09 来自:开发者社区

详解Mybatis之自动映射 & 自定义映射问题(下)

4.3 分步查询 为什么使用分步查询【分步查询优势】?将多表连接查询,改为【分步单表查询】,从而提高程序运行效率4.3.1 一对一的关联关系用法案例使用分步查询实现通过员工id获取员工信息及员工所属的部门信息,比如说1.通过员工id获取员工信息,2.通过员工信息中的部门id获得所属部门得信息(员工与部门是一对一的关系,即一个员工只能归属一个部门)代码示例如下:①在EmployeeMapper接口....

详解Mybatis之自动映射 & 自定义映射问题(下)
文章 2023-08-09 来自:开发者社区

详解Mybatis之自动映射 & 自定义映射问题(上)

编译软件:IntelliJ IDEA 2019.2.4 x64操作系统:win10 x64 位 家庭版Maven版本:apache-maven-3.6.3Mybatis版本:3.5.6一、Mybatis中的自动映射是什么?Mybatis中的自动映射不是什么高大上的技术名词,而是我们使用Mybatis框架进行持久化层开发时常用select元素中的常见属性resultType,它可以自动将数据库内表....

详解Mybatis之自动映射 & 自定义映射问题(上)
文章 2023-08-03 来自:开发者社区

MyBatis动态设置表名 获取添加功能自增的主键 自定义映射

MyBatis动态设置表名 获取添加功能自增的主键 自定义映射动态设置表名获取添加功能自增的主键自定义映射解决字段名和属性名不一致的情况为字段起别名,保持和属性名的一致设置全局配置,保持和属性名的一致通过resultMap设置自定义的映射关系动态设置表名mapper接口:映射文件: <!--List<TUser> getUserByTableName(@Param("ta...

MyBatis动态设置表名 获取添加功能自增的主键 自定义映射
文章 2023-02-22 来自:开发者社区

十、MyBatis自定义映射resultMap

准备数据库表         t_student表实体类对象         为了体现出resultMap的特点,所以如下类作为实体类对象。MyBatis自定义映射resultMap        这里以通过查询一条数据进行演示(以id作为参数进行查询)。映射接口public.....

十、MyBatis自定义映射resultMap
文章 2022-06-18 来自:开发者社区

MyBatis-Plus——Mapper接口中使用自定义的CRUD方法及Mapper.xml映射文件

1.案例详解首先在Navicat中创建一张表。创建一个SpringBoot工程,在pom文件中添加所需依赖。 <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ter&...

MyBatis-Plus——Mapper接口中使用自定义的CRUD方法及Mapper.xml映射文件
文章 2022-04-05 来自:开发者社区

Mybatis自定义映射--ResultMap

ResultType是默认映射,要求字段名要和属性名一致,但是如果我们数据库中的表的字段名和实体类的属性名不一致怎么办呢?这个时候就得用ResultMap来自定义映射前期准备先准备两张表,一张是员工表,一张部门表1.解决字段名和属性名不一致的情况1.1方法一 为字段起别名,保持属性名和字段名的一致当我们写的实体类的属性遵循驼峰,属性名和字段名不一致的话,如果我们使用sql语句的返回值类型用的是r....

Mybatis自定义映射--ResultMap

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

Apache Spark 中国技术社区

阿里巴巴开源大数据技术团队成立 Apache Spark 中国技术社区,定期推送精彩案例,问答区数个 Spark 技术同学每日在线答疑,只为营造 Spark 技术交流氛围,欢迎加入!

+关注